From Umberto I Avenue to Montemonaco by bus and train
To get from Umberto I Avenue to Montemonaco you’ll need to take one train line and 2 bus lines: take the R train from Civitanova Marche-Montegranaro station to Ascoli Piceno station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 22EXTR bus and finally take the 21EXTR bus from Ponte Aso station to Montemonaco station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 6 hr 23 min.
